What is a Hash Rate?
A hash rate is a measure of the computational power of a mining rig or a mining pool. It represents the number of hashes per second that a device can perform. In the context of Bitcoin mining, a hash rate is used to determine the likelihood of a miner finding a valid block and earning Bitcoin rewards.
The higher the hash rate, the more likely a miner is to find a valid block. However, it is essential to note that a higher hash rate also means higher electricity costs and hardware expenses. Therefore, finding the right balance between hash rate and cost is crucial for successful Bitcoin mining.
